#1c174b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c174b is composed of 11% red, 9%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.7% cyan, 69.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 70.6% black. It has a hue angle of 245.8 degrees, a saturation of 53.1% and a lightness of 19.2%. #1c174b color hex could be obtained by blending #382e96 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

#1c174b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1c174b has RGB values of R:28, G:23, B:75 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 1840971.

Shades and Tints of #1c174b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06050f is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
